M.160201 is an artwork by Toshio Iezumi, from his 'Move' series.

The Japanese artist’s glass sculptures surprises viewers through their changing aspects and their elegant and poetic presence.  Shades of highly intense or very clear green, real or illusionary volumes, internal spaces that one tries to decipher, unexpected distortions reflected on the surface, an impression of movement created by alternating concave and convex forms...  Glass, with its ability to refract light, is the absolute protagonist in these pieces, brought out by the artist’s skill and experience.  The sculpture’s organic form draws on nature’s elements: the waves made by the wind on the water or grass, the sea’s waves, the stones’ roundness and smoothness.

Toshio Iezumi ‘s sculpturing technique is long and complex.  He starts by gluing glass sheets together, tinted green by the iron content, creating a deeper hued block of glass. He then uses an angle grinder, normally used for carving stone, to shape the sculpture. The next step is to remove the surface scratches with abrasive grinding grits. Finally, polishing with a felt buff gives the sculpture its transparency, and totally changes its appearance. The artist is looking for the perfect balance between shape (with grinding) and texture (with polishing), to bring out the artwork.

In the ‘Move’ series, which began in the 2000’s, the artist presented vertical sculptures standing with a powerful and delicate presence. For the series, Toshio Iezumi worked especially on the waves, alternating convex and concave forms to give the sculptures an effect of movement. The artist also uses a semi-transparent mirror, placed inside the artwork to further accentuate the reflections and light diffusion.
